2011 ICD-9-CM Diagnosis Code 394.9
Other and unspecified mitral valve diseases
- Short description: Mitral valve dis NEC/NOS.
- ICD-9-CM 394.9 is a billable medical code that can be used to specify a diagnosis on a reimbursement claim.
- You are viewing the 2011 version of ICD-9-CM 394.9.
- More recent version(s) of ICD-9-CM 394.9: 2012 2013.
394.9 Alternative Terminology
- Chronic rheumatic mitral valve
- Mitral sub-valve apparatus calcification
- Mitral sub-valve apparatus fibrosis
- Mitral valve annular calcification, rheumatic
- Mitral valve disease, rheumatic
- Mitral valve sclerosis
- Rheumatic disease of mitral valve
- Rheumatic mitral disease
- Rheumatic mitral valve annular calcification
- Rheumatic mitral valve failure
- Rheumatic mitral valve leaflet changes

Convert 394.9 to ICD-10-CM 

ICD-9-CM 394.9 converts approximately to:
- 2013 ICD-10-CM I05.8 Other rheumatic mitral valve diseases
